Transaction 16656329a8be6232d47c7767f8f166e9633d2e9bdadbb87e5a4fe8ce23912400

11 Input
2 Outputs
  • 16656329a8be6232d47c7767f8f166e9633d2e9bdadbb87e5a4fe8ce23912400:0
  • value  1000336
    address  3B3weoRTmkY7k3YRqLucjGUA8z7nJZu6yw
  • 16656329a8be6232d47c7767f8f166e9633d2e9bdadbb87e5a4fe8ce23912400:1
  • value  79396286
    address  3FNBUxqGrppL2269NGgaLgEuw8uUSuGjec